Today I got Anya a 40-gallon breeder tank, as it was on sale at my local pet shop. It was quite the, um, adventure getting it into the house and to the hamster room myself, but it is there and she is all moved in. I don't think she's ever had so much space in her life. She seemed so happy running all over and exploring, and she has much deeper substrate now. I also weighed her, but I can't remember exactly what her weight was. I think it was 93 grams, but I don't know if that can be right. She was the runt of her litter, and she does seem very small, but I stupidly just forgot to write down the weight, I was so excited to transfer her to her new cage.
She is very friendly and seems to like being petted and held, but I want to let her settle in before I really try to tame her and get her used to me.

Isn't she lovely? And enjoying that silent Runner, by the looks of it! 93g for 2-3 months old is good, I think. Very good for 2 months, on the small side for 3 but still perfectly fine. She looks very healthy in her photos, so I don't think you need worry.
